3.2 QAT官方案例

官方的案例进行一个分析,对整个 pipeline 有一个总体的把握。

该官方案例整体流程如下:

  • 定义我们的模型
  • 对模型插入 QDQ 节点
  • 统计 QDQ 节点的 range 和 scale
  • 做敏感层分析(需要知道,那个层对精度指标影响较大,关闭对精度影响较大的层)
  • 导出一个带有 QDQ 节点的 PTQ 模型
  • 对模型进行 finetune

在上面的示例代码中,首先利用 pytorch-quantization 对加载的预训练模型进行 QDQ 节点的插入,然后对模型进行校准,统计 QDQ 节点的 range 和 scale,通过调用 collect_stats 函数对模型的量化节点进行统计。该函数会遍历模型中的量化节点,并根据给定的数据加载器,对一定数量的批次数据进行前向传播,收集统计信息,包括最大值、最小值等。这些统计信息用于后续的量化参数计算

接下来我们会通过调用 build_sensitivity_profile 函数进行敏感层分析。该函数针对每个量化层,在模型中启动该层,然后再测试数据上进行评估。评估结果可以帮助判断哪些层对精度影响较大,从而可以选择关那些对精度影响较大的层

最后使用 SGD 优化器对进行微调,调用 export_onnx 函数将带有 QDQ 节点的模型导出为ONNX格式
